Inserting and Removing Devices
5.2.1
Inserting the I/O Module
1.
Position the I/O module in such a way that the groove and spring are
connected to the preceding and following components.
Figure 11: Inserting I/O Module (Example)
2.
Press the I/O module into the assembly until the I/O module snaps into the
carrier rail.
Figure 12: Snap the I/O Module into Place (Example)
3.
Check that the I/O module is seated securely on the carrier rail and in the
assembly. The I/O module must not be inserted crooked or askew.
